Telecommunications providers are deploying artificial intelligence to combat the $25 billion phone scam epidemic. AI systems analyze call patterns, verify identities, and adapt to evolving fraud tactics in real-time protection.
The AI advantage in telco is becoming increasingly critical as phone scams escalate into a $25 billion annual problem affecting 21% of adults. According to the 2024 Public Interest Network report, sophisticated fraud attempts are undermining trust in voice communications, pushing communications service providers to deploy artificial intelligence as their primary defense mechanism against evolving threats.
